The Premier League witnessed a thrilling weekend of football, with standout performances and surprising upsets. Arsenal, in particular, stole the show with a resounding victory over Bournemouth, while Liverpool, Manchester City, and Manchester United faced unexpected defeats.

Arsenal Triumph Over Bournemouth

Arsenal showcased their dominance as they crushed winless Bournemouth with a scoreline of 4-0 at the Vitality Stadium. This win marked a strong comeback for Arsenal after their 2-2 draw against Tottenham the previous weekend.

The Gunners wasted no time, with Bukayo Saka opening the scoring by heading in the rebound from Gabriel Jesus’ effort. Martin Odegaard added to their lead with a well-converted penalty, providing Mikel Arteta’s side with a comfortable advantage at halftime.

The second half continued in Arsenal’s favor, with Kai Havertz scoring his first goal for the club from the penalty spot. Ben White sealed the deal with a headed goal from Odegaard’s free-kick in added time.

Bournemouth’s struggles continued, as they dropped into the bottom three with no wins in their first seven league matches under new manager Andoni Iraola.

Manchester United’s Home Defeat

Manchester United suffered their second consecutive home defeat in the Premier League, this time against Crystal Palace. Joachim Andersen’s superb strike secured an impressive victory for the visitors.

Despite a spirited effort, Manchester United couldn’t break through Palace’s defense. Goalkeeper Sam Johnstone’s outstanding performance denied the hosts any goals. As a result, Crystal Palace claimed a 1-0 victory, moving above their opponents to ninth place, while Manchester United dropped to 10th. This marked a challenging start to the season for Erik ten Hag’s side.

Wolves Stun Manchester City

Manchester City’s unbeaten run in the Premier League came to an end as they faced a shocking 2-1 defeat against Wolves at Molineux. Hwang Hee-chan scored the decisive second-half winner for Wolves.

Despite City’s efforts, they struggled to find their usual control, and striker Erling Haaland had limited opportunities. Julian Alvarez’s brilliant free-kick and Ruben Dias’ own goal had initially given Manchester City hope, but Wolves fought back to secure a surprising victory.

This defeat marked a rare setback for Pep Guardiola’s side, who had been dominant in the league.

Tottenham Edges Nine-Man Liverpool

In an eventful and contentious Premier League clash, Tottenham secured a late victory over nine-man Liverpool. Joel Matip’s own goal deep into stoppage time gave Spurs the win.

Liverpool faced controversy with two red cards, leaving them with just nine players on the field. The Reds were aggrieved by VAR decisions, including a disallowed goal by Luis Diaz. Captain Son Heung-min scored for Tottenham, but Cody Gakpo equalized for Liverpool.

In the dying moments of the game, Matip’s unfortunate own goal handed Tottenham a dramatic win. This defeat marked Liverpool’s first of the season, while Tottenham celebrated a thrilling victory.

SATURDAY’S RESULTS

Aston Villa 6-1 Brighton

Bournemouth 0-4 Arsenal

Everton 1-2 Luton

Manchester United 0-1 Crystal Palace

Newcastle 2-0 Burnley

West Ham 2-0 Sheffield United

Wolves 2-1 Manchester City

Tottenham 2-1 Liverpool

The Premier League delivered excitement and surprises, showcasing the unpredictability and drama that fans love about football.
